驾照考试系统课程设计_第1页
驾照考试系统课程设计_第2页
驾照考试系统课程设计_第3页
驾照考试系统课程设计_第4页
驾照考试系统课程设计_第5页
已阅读5页,还剩19页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

驾照考试系统课程设计REPORTING目录课程设计概述驾照考试系统需求分析驾照考试系统设计驾照考试系统实现驾照考试系统测试与评估总结与展望PART01课程设计概述REPORTING掌握驾照考试系统的基本原理和功能。培养学员具备独立开发驾照考试系统的能力。课程设计目标学会驾照考试系统的设计和开发流程。提高学员的编程技能和系统设计能力。课程设计背景随着汽车普及率的提高,驾照考试需求不断增加。基于计算机技术的驾照考试系统逐渐成为发展趋势。传统驾照考试方式存在效率低下、管理不便等问题。驾照考试系统具有公正、高效、便捷等优点,受到广泛欢迎。02030401课程设计意义提高驾照考试的效率和公正性,减少人为因素干扰。方便学员随时随地进行驾照考试练习。降低驾照考试成本,减轻考试机构工作压力。促进计算机技术在驾培领域的应用和发展。PART02驾照考试系统需求分析REPORTING用户需求分析用户群体驾照考试系统的用户群体主要包括考生、驾校、考试中心和交通管理部门。用户需求特点用户需求主要包括方便、高效、安全和公正的考试体验,同时要求系统能够提供全面的考试服务,满足不同用户的需求。考试管理功能考生管理功能驾校管理功能统计分析功能功能需求分析系统应具备考试报名、考试安排、考试监控和成绩管理等基本功能。系统应能够管理驾校信息,包括驾校资质、教练员信息等。系统应能够管理考生信息,包括个人信息、考试成绩和预约考试等。系统应具备对考试数据进行分析和统计的功能,以便对考试情况进行评估和改进。系统应具备高效、稳定和可靠的性能,能够满足大规模并发访问和数据存储的需求。系统性能系统安全系统易用性系统可维护性系统应采取有效的安全措施,保障用户数据的安全性和保密性,防止数据泄露和非法访问。系统应具备良好的用户界面和操作流程,方便用户使用和操作。系统应具备可维护性和可扩展性,方便进行升级和维护。非功能需求分析PART03驾照考试系统设计REPORTING

系统架构设计架构概述本系统采用B/S架构,分为前端和后端两部分。前端主要负责用户交互,后端负责业务逻辑处理和数据存储。技术选型选用SpringBoot作为后端框架,使用MyBatis作为持久层框架,前端则采用Vue.js构建用户界面。模块划分系统分为用户模块、考试模块、成绩模块和系统管理模块,各模块之间相互独立,降低耦合度。功能布局界面分为头部、主体和底部三个部分,头部包含系统logo和导航栏,主体部分根据不同功能划分区域,底部为版权信息。交互设计优化表单填写、按钮点击等交互体验,使用户操作便捷、高效。设计风格采用简洁、大方的设计风格,使用户界面符合现代审美标准。系统界面设计数据库选择选用MySQL作为数据库管理系统,确保数据存储的安全性和稳定性。数据表设计根据系统需求设计数据表,包括用户表、考试表、成绩表等,每个表包含必要的字段和数据类型。索引优化针对常用查询字段建立索引,提高数据查询效率。系统数据库设计PART04驾照考试系统实现REPORTING123选择一个稳定、安全的操作系统作为驾照考试系统的运行环境,如WindowsServer或Linux。操作系统选择一个适合大规模数据存储和处理的数据库管理系统,如MySQL或Oracle。数据库确保系统能够稳定地与外部系统进行数据交换和通信,采用可靠的网络设备和协议。网络环境系统开发环境使用HTML、CSS和JavaScript等前端技术构建用户友好的界面,配合AJAX或jQuery实现异步通信。前端技术根据系统需求选择合适的后端技术,如Java、Python或PHP等,用于处理业务逻辑和数据存储。后端技术利用现有的框架和库提高开发效率,如Spring、Django或Bootstrap等。框架与库系统开发技术集成开发环境(IDE)选择一款功能强大的集成开发环境,如Eclipse、VisualStudioCode或PyCharm等。版本控制系统采用Git或其他版本控制系统,方便团队成员协同开发和代码管理。测试工具使用自动化测试工具进行系统测试,如Selenium、JMeter或Postman等。系统开发工具030201PART05驾照考试系统测试与评估REPORTING对系统的各个模块进行单独测试,确保每个模块的功能正常。单元测试将各个模块组合在一起进行测试,确保模块之间的协调性和整体功能的稳定性。集成测试模拟多用户同时访问系统,测试系统的负载能力和性能。负载测试评估系统对外部攻击的防范能力,确保数据的安全性和完整性。安全性测试系统测试方案系统测试结果01单元测试通过率:98%02集成测试通过率:95%03负载测试通过率:80%04安全性测试通过率:90%系统基本功能完善,但部分高级功能需要进一步优化。系统功能评估系统响应速度较快,但在高负载情况下性能有所下降。系统性能评估系统具备一定的安全防护能力,但仍需加强。系统安全性评估系统评估报告PART06总结与展望REPORTING驾照考试系统概述系统需求分析系统设计与实现系统测试与优化课程设计总结通过对实际应用场景的调研和分析,确定了驾照考试系统的需求,包括考生信息管理、考试科目管理、考试成绩管理等功能。根据需求分析结果,设计了驾

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论